Visitors to the Lake District National Park are drawn to the lively twin towns of Bowness and Windermere because each one offers a variety of adjacent attractions, facilities, a movie theatre, shopping, and restaurants to satisfy all interests. Windermere Lake Cruises in Bowness offers a choice of boat cruises and boat rental options to Brockhole, Ambleside, and Lakeside (at the southern end of the lake where the Lakeside Aquarium and the Lakeside and Haverthwaite Railway are situated). The Old Laundry Theatre and the World of Beatrix Potter Attraction are separated by 1.5 kilometres. It takes 30 minutes to walk to Orrest Head to take in the breathtaking vista of far-reaching views over the lake and nearby fells, which served as the inspiration for Alfred Wainwright to create his series of renowned guidebooks. The historic villages of Grasmere, Ambleside, and Troutbeck are only a short drive away, while Brockhole, which provides high wire tree top activities, is three miles distant. For those with greater energy, marine centres near the lake offer a range of watersports. With easy access to attractions like the stunning Langdales, Beatrix Potter's Hill Top House at Far Sawrey, Coniston, Grizedale Forest Park with its delightful walks and famous outdoor sculptures, mountain biking and "Go-Ape" adventure park, Ullswater, Kendal, and Keswick, stone circles, Roman forts, and England's highest mountain, Scafell Pike, the area is perfectly situated for exploring everything this region has to offer.

Accommodation

Second-floor apartment.

Three bedrooms: 1 x king-size, 1 x double with en-suite bath, shower over, basin, heated towel rail and WC, 1 x twin.

Shower room with walk-in shower, basin, heated towel rail and WC.

Open-plan living space with kitchen, dining area and sitting area

Gas central heating.

Electric oven, induction hob, microwave, fridge/freezer, dishwasher.

Smart TV, WiFi.

Fuel and power included in rent.

Bed linen and towels included in rent.

Off-road parking for 2 cars.

Communal gardens with lawn and furniture.

Two well-behaved pets welcome.

Sorry, no smoking.

Shop 1.2 miles, pub 0.5 miles, lake 0.1 miles.

Note: Child facilities not provided.

Note: Check-in from 4pm, check-out at 10am
